How to find English speaking lawyers in Benidorm?
For English-speaking residents, the language barrier can be a significant hurdle. To find an English-speaking Spanish solicitor in Benidorm, start by researching online directories and legal forums. Many law firms in Benidorm cater specifically to the expatriate community, offering bilingual services.
Word-of-mouth recommendations can also be invaluable. Tap into the expat community for referrals to lawyers who have successfully assisted others in similar situations. Additionally, professional bodies such as the local bar association may provide lists of lawyers with English language capabilities.
Don’t hesitate to inquire about language proficiency directly when contacting firms. Many of the top law offices will be proud to advertise their multi-lingual staff.

How long does the bankruptcy process typically take in Spain?
The duration of the bankruptcy process in Spain can range from a few months to several years, depending on the case’s complexity and whether it’s a personal or corporate bankruptcy. An experienced bankruptcy lawyer can provide a more accurate timeline after reviewing your situation.
What documents do you need to prepare for a bankruptcy filing in Benidorm?
Key documents for a bankruptcy filing include:
- A detailed list of assets and liabilities
- Proof of income and expenses
- Tax returns for the last few years
- Contracts, loan agreements, and any other relevant financial documentation
